The platform is enabled to communicate with a radio device via a wireless network connection of a first subscription of the radio device. The method comprises falling back to a second subscription, thereby enabling the connectivity service platform to communicate with the radio device via a wireless network connection of said second subscription of the radio device instead of the first subscription. The method also comprises receiving a request message from the radio device via the network connection of the first subscription. The method also comprises sending a reject message to the radio device, in response to the received request message and in view of the platform having fallen back to the second subscription. The reject message comprises a fall-back indication for instructing the radio device to fall back from the first subscription."},"analysis":{"summary":null,"layman_explanation":null,"technical_analysis":null,"business_analysis":null,"faqs":null,"topics":[],"tech_cluster":null},"seo":{"title":"Subscription fall-back in a radio communication network","description":"A method is described herein that is performed by a connectivity service platform in a communication network.
